FAQ: What is tokyo ghoul re?
- Tokyo Ghoul:re is the sequel manga to Sui Ishida’s Tokyo Ghoul that follows Kaneki’s path from being Haise Sasaki to regaining his memory and becoming the One-Eyed King. It is also the collective title of the third and fourth seasons of the anime.

Is kaneki in Tokyo Ghoul re?
The sequel series Tokyo Ghoul:re follows an amnesiac Kaneki under the new identity of Haise Sasaki (the result of horrific brain damage sustained from Kishō Arima).

Is kaneki’s daughter a ghoul?
Powers and Abilities. Ichika is a natural-born one-eyed ghoul. It is not known whether she will inherit the abilities of her parents. Like other natural-born hybrids, she is able to consume human food.
